Putin’s Peace Proposal ‘Constructive Step’ Toward Stopping ‘Proxy War Between Nuclear Powers’

President addresses Russian and foreign press, outlining a renewed Russian offer for direct “negotiations without any preconditions” with . May 11, 2025.

“Alternative for shares the assessment of US President that Ukraine should accept the offer to engage in direct bilateral talks with – without preconditions, such as the 30-day ceasefire demanded by the so-called ‘Coalition of the Willing,’” AfD lawmaker told Sputnik.

“Putin’s proposal represents a serious and constructive step toward de-escalation and a potential peace settlement. In a conflict that – as even US Secretary of State Marco Rubio has acknowledged – has become a proxy war between two nuclear powers, ideological rigidity must give way to pragmatic diplomacy,” Kotre emphasized.

Differing Approaches

The lawmaker highlighted differences between Russia and Ukraine/the West’s stance toward dialogue.

To this point, Russia has pursued “bilateral negotiations and concrete geopolitical security guarantees,” while Ukraine and the West, especially before Trump’s election, pursued “escalation, sanctions and military buildup, often driven by external interests rather than by Europe’s own security needs.”
